WHAT CAN MALE RHINOPLASTY ADDRESS?

  • A crooked nose
  • A nose that is out of proportion to the face (too large or too small)
  • A hump or depression on the nasal bridge (seen on the profile)
  • A nose that is too wide when viewed head-on
  • A nasal tip that droops or is thick and enlarged
  • Nostrils that excessively flare outward
  • A previous injury that has resulted in asymmetry
  • An obstructive airway and problems with breathing/snoring

WHAT HAPPENS DURING THE RHINOPLASTY PROCEDURE?

OPEN TECHNIQUE

Most rhinoplasty surgeries are performed with the patient under general anesthesia. Your specific procedure plan will be fully customized by Dr. Delgado to meet your specific cosmetic or functional goals. The most common technique that Dr. Delgado performs for rhinoplasty in Napa Valley is the “open” technique. In the open technique, Dr. Delgado creates an incision at the base of the nose, allowing for better exposure and more accuracy.

REFINEMENT

This allows him access to the entire nasal anatomy. He will elevate the skin from the cartilage and bone, and will then trim the nasal tip cartilage. The nasal bone will be reduced, enhanced, or narrowed. If needed, the nasal passage will also be addressed. After this, the nasal tip will be further refined with suture techniques and cartilage-sparing procedures. Once complete, the incisions are closed and an external cast is molded into place.

RECOVERY

The first hours after surgery will be spent in the recovery room until you are fully alert. Once you’re awake and alert, you’ll be able to go home. It’s incredibly important that you keep your head and back elevated at 45-60 degrees to reduce swelling. Although there is very little pain during recovery from rhinoplasty, your nose will feel swollen and stuffy.

High intensity exercise and sports should be avoided for 4-6 weeks. Contact lenses can be worn after a few days. If you wear glasses, they can be worn gently for short periods, initially. Your sutures and nasal cast are removed in 5-7 days, and you may return to work or social activities within one week. 80% of the swelling will subside in 4-6 weeks, but the remaining 20% will gradually resolve over the next 5-9 months. You will notice slight changes in swelling from day to day.

Will my nose be broken during surgery?

Your nose will be broken if there is a bump or prominence on the top of the nose, as seen on your profile. This is an important factor of the procedure in order to narrow the dorsum of the nose.

What risks are involved?

There is the risk of bleeding, infection, or anesthetic problems. In approximately 15% of rhinoplasty cases, there are minor deformities present, and corrective surgery is usually minor.
